Osun Assembly Passes Local Government Amendment Bill

The Osun State House of Assembly has passed a bill amending certain provisions of the state’s local government law.

The News Agency of Nigeria (NAN) reports that the bill, titled ‘Osun State Local Government Amendment No. 2 Bill, 2026’, was approved after its third reading during the Assembly’s plenary session held in Osogbo on Monday.

Earlier in the session, the chairman of the House Committee on Public Accounts, Lawal Bamidele, presented the committee’s report on the bill and outlined its recommendations.

Following the presentation, the Speaker of the Assembly, Adewale Egbedun, called for the adoption of the report, a motion which was moved by the Majority Leader, Babajide Adewumi. Adewumi also moved the motion for the third reading of the bill, which was subsequently passed by the House.

NAN reports that the amendment seeks to review the Osun State Local Government Law, Cap 72, Vol. IV, Laws of Osun State 2002, along with other related provisions.
